The Goodyear Wrangler All-Terrain Adventure with Kevlar tires receive mixed reviews, with many customers praising their performance and durability, while others express disappointment.
The Goodyear Wrangler All-Terrain Adventure with Kevlar tires appear to be a solid choice for those seeking a versatile all-terrain tire with good on-road manners. They perform well in various conditions and offer a quiet ride for an all-terrain tire. However, their performance in heavy snow is questionable, and some users experienced durability issues. The tires seem best suited for light to moderate off-road use and everyday driving, but may not be ideal for extreme conditions or heavy-duty applications.
Positive highlights
Excellent balance between on-road manners and off-road capability. Quiet ride on highways. Great traction in various conditions, including wet roads and light snow. Long-lasting tread life for many users. Sturdy sidewalls, with some praising the Kevlar reinforcement. Good value for money.
Negative highlights
Some users report a stiffer ride compared to other tire models. Poor performance in heavy snow and for plowing, according to a few reviewers. A few cases of tire failure or steel belt issues. Some found them overpriced compared to similar options.

I have a history of owning muscle cars and trucks. I've spent 8 years operating tow trucks. I have experience driving in all weather conditions with the exception of snow; with many brands of tires. I also do mobile tire service for a major automobile company.
Let me tell you. The first week I put a full set of "Goodyear Wrangler All-Terrain Adventure with Kevlar" I went where my tow truck couldn't; Mud slurry six-inch deep. Chaining to my buddy's FJ Cruiser we were able to pull another vehicle out onto dry road.
A couple years later I pulled an empty 33' gooseneck trailer from Colorado to California with the same truck and tires. Solid traction and handling.
A year after that I got into a collision with another car with the brunt of the hit being the front passenger quarter panel and tire/wheel. As a former tow truck operator, I've seen sidewalls easily blow out due to such impacts; But because the sidewalls are Kevlar reinforced only the outer layer was slashed thus saved the tire. Since then, I've done about 8,000 miles with no issue.
50,000 miles on these tires with 10,000 miles left.
So, Would I buy these tires again? Absolutely.

The Goodyear Wrangler All-Terrain Adventure with Kevlar is an all-terrain tire that's designed for use on SUVs, Jeeps, and light trucks and offers drivers superior traction on paved, unpaved, wet, and icy roads, along with a 60,000 mile limited manufacturer tread life warranty.
Features & Benefits
All-terrain tread
Black sidewall
60,000 mile limited manufacturer tread life warranty
Three Peak Mountain Snowflake certified for use in moderate to severe winter weather conditions
Built with DuPont Kevlar for added strength in off-road driving
Are you looking for a tire that is designed to conquer any terrain or weather? Take a look at the Goodyear Wrangler All-Terrain Adventure with Kevlar, which designed to offer superior traction on- and off-road. The tire features Durawall Technology in its sidewall for resistance against cuts and chips, DuPont Kevlar for added strength, and a special rubber compound with biting edges for enhanced traction on icy roads. Commonly used on vehicles such as the Chevrolet Colorado, Ford F-150, GMC Canyon, Jeep Wrangler, and Toyota Tacoma, the Wrangler All-Terrain Adventure With Kevlar offers excellent overall performance.
